P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: درخواست راهنمایی در خصوص سرور مجازی یا ابری برای node.js



serialbaran
April 22nd, 2015, 07:23
با سلام
دوستان برای بستر node.js نیاز به سرور دارم. ممنون میشم اگر به این سوالات پاسخ بدید. برای اینکه نظم تاپیک هم به هم نریزه بعد از به نتیجه رسیدن این تاپیک برای آفر یک تاپیک جدید در بخش فروش ایجاد میکنم که اینجا فقط سوالات بررسی بشه.

(ممنون میشم با ذکر شماره جواب بدید)
1) سرور مجازی پیشنهاد میدید یا سرویس های ابری که خودشون زیرساخت کانفیگ شده و مدیریت شده دارن؟؟
2) من تا الان سرور مجازی نداشتم راه انداختن زیرساخت های لازم روی سرور مجازی با کاری که رو سیستم خودم به صورت لوکال انجام میدم چقدر تفاوت داره؟؟ کار دشواری هست یا میشه انجام داد؟
3) کدوم مجازی ساز رو پیشنهاد میدید؟؟
4) سورس کدهای مربوطه روی سرور مجازی مشابه هاست های اشتراکی برای شرکت سرویس دهنده قابل دسترس هست یا امنیت سورس کدها بیشتره؟؟ اگر توضیح بدید به چه صورت ممنون میشم.
5)‌ برای بستر node.js و mongoDB سرور با چه کانفیگی رو پیشنهاد میدید که تقریبا جوابگو باشه برای شروع؟؟ (از نظر رم و پردازنده و ...)

iFire
April 22nd, 2015, 08:10
سلام
۱.بستگی به نیازتون داره .. قطعا سرورهای ابری بهتر هستن و البته خیلی گرونتر
یک نمونه از سرویس دهنده ها : http://heroku.com/pricing
۲.بستگی به سیستم عامل شما و سیتم عامل سرور داره … میتونید یاد بگیرید مطالب عمومی تو اینترنت زیاد هست. البته واسه nodejs لینوکس خیلی خیلی بهتر از ویندوز جواب میده. ولی اگر از سرویس دهنده های ابری استفاده کنید هم کانفیگ بهتری دارید هم اینکه نیاز نیست خودتون رو درگیر کارای سرور و …. کنید! پروژه رو آپلود می کنید رو Git و بقیه کارهارو خوشون انجام میدن ;)
۳.تو این زمینه تخصص آنچنانی ندارم دوستان بهتر می تونن راهنمایی کنن
۴.امنیت بالاتری رو داره نسبت به هاست اشتراکی
۵.کانفیگ خاصی نمیخواد nodejs به اندازه کافی پرفرمنس بالایی داره که نیاز به سخت افزار قوی نیست شاید واسه شروع رم یک گیگ با یه سی پی یو معمولی جواب کارتون رو بده (‌شایدم کانفیگ کمتر )
موفق باشید...

serialbaran
April 23rd, 2015, 19:00
سلام
۱.بستگی به نیازتون داره .. قطعا سرورهای ابری بهتر هستن و البته خیلی گرونتر
یک نمونه از سرویس دهنده ها : http://heroku.com/pricing
۲.بستگی به سیستم عامل شما و سیتم عامل سرور داره … میتونید یاد بگیرید مطالب عمومی تو اینترنت زیاد هست. البته واسه nodejs لینوکس خیلی خیلی بهتر از ویندوز جواب میده. ولی اگر از سرویس دهنده های ابری استفاده کنید هم کانفیگ بهتری دارید هم اینکه نیاز نیست خودتون رو درگیر کارای سرور و …. کنید! پروژه رو آپلود می کنید رو git و بقیه کارهارو خوشون انجام میدن ;)
۳.تو این زمینه تخصص آنچنانی ندارم دوستان بهتر می تونن راهنمایی کنن
۴.امنیت بالاتری رو داره نسبت به هاست اشتراکی
۵.کانفیگ خاصی نمیخواد nodejs به اندازه کافی پرفرمنس بالایی داره که نیاز به سخت افزار قوی نیست شاید واسه شروع رم یک گیگ با یه سی پی یو معمولی جواب کارتون رو بده (‌شایدم کانفیگ کمتر )
موفق باشید...

ممنون از توجهتون
در مورد امنیت کدها (سوال چهارم) ممنون میشم یه مقدار بیشتر توضیح بدید. از چه نظر امنیت بیشتره؟؟ یعنی شرکتی که vps میده به فایل های داخل سرور مجازی مشتریش دسترسی نداره؟؟

iFire
April 23rd, 2015, 19:23
خواهش می کنم
ببینید در دو حالت که مدیر سرور دسترسی داره
ولی روی هاست اشتراکی اگه کسی یه هاست بخره و سرور هم خوب کانفیگ نشده باشه براحتی میتونه به سایت های دیگه روی سرور دسترسی پیدا کنه و …
در کل امنیت هاست اشتراکی کمتر از سرور مجازی هست ( این موارد برای سرورهای لینوکس با کنترل پنل سی پنل هست )
اگر برای نود مدنظرتون هست قضیه اونها کمی فرق می کنه و چون توسعه دهنده و برنامه نویس در این زمینه کم هست امنیتشون بالا هست البته فعلا
مثل ویندوز و مکینتاش میمونه! چون کاربران ویندوز خیلی بیشتر از مکینتاش هست هکر هم وقتش رو واسه وندوز میذاره تا کاربران رو هک کنه و این دلیل بر این نمیشه که بگیم مکینتاش یا لینوکس ویروسی نمیشن!
البته یه سری مباحث هم مربوط سیستم عامل و … میشه که بحثش جداست …
سوالی باشه درخدمتم

serialbaran
April 24th, 2015, 06:53
خواهش می کنم
ببینید در دو حالت که مدیر سرور دسترسی داره
...

ممنون از توجهتون
من همیشه فکر میکردم وقتی از VPS استفاده میکنیم دیگه ادمین سرور به فایل های ما (و کلا سیستم ما) دسترسی نداره چون کلا سیستم عامل واس ماس و پسورد و اینجور مسائل رو نداره طرف و نهایت میتونه ریست کنه یا خاموش کنه و کارهای اینجوری.
پس اشتباه فکر میکردم؟؟ #-o